What are the methods of philosophizing? - Socratic Method, Dialectical Method, Phenomenological Method, Hermeneutics, It refers to a process of asking open-ended question; an art of questioning.s - Socratic Method, The goal of this method is a method of studying and understand real development and change. - Dialectical Method, Dialectics is derived from the Greek word ____ which means to _____. - dialego, debate or discuss, Formula of dialectical method - T vs. A = S, refer to a thesis that opposes the given thesis. - Antithesis, In the formula of the dialectical method, it refers to a claim, hypothesis, and/or speculation. - Thesis, The result of the conflict of the thesis and antithesis - Synthesis, A method that refers to the process whereby a person suspends his/her beliefs. - Phenomenological Method, The goal of this method of philosophizing is to capture the truth of the text. - Hermeneutics, An example of this process is letting go of one's biases/prejudices. - Bracketing, After bracketing this is a process of the realization of the essence. - Eidetic Reduction, Hermeneutics term derived from hermeneuein which means: - to interpret/interpretation, Phenomenon means - It means appearance, Logos - It means to study or reason,
